Who is Rebecca Heinrich?
Rebecca Heinrich is an American defense analyst, political commentator, and senior fellow at the Hudson Institute, one of Washington’s leading think tanks. She has dedicated her career to strengthening U.S. national defense policy, with a focus on nuclear deterrence, missile defense, and strategic stability. Over the past decade, Heinrich has become a familiar face to television audiences, offering expert opinions on networks like Fox News and CNN.
Her articulate breakdowns of complex security topics make her a go-to expert for policymakers, journalists, and citizens interested in U.S. defense strategy.

Professional Career Journey
Rebecca Heinrich career began in the corridors of Washington, where she served as a policy advisor and researcher. Over time, she transitioned from behind-the-scenes policymaking to a public voice in national defense. Her deep insights and commitment to U.S. security led to her joining the Hudson Institute, where she currently serves as a Senior Fellow.
At Hudson, she focuses on strengthening nuclear deterrence, missile defense systems, and strategic security policies. Her research often examines how the U.S. can stay ahead of global threats while maintaining peace through strength — a philosophy that defines her professional identity.
